Burberry checks out contenders to replace Murphy as chairman

Burberry is kicking off a formal search for a new chairman nearly a year after installing the latest in a string of chief executives charged with reviving the luxury fashion brand.

Sky News understands that Burberry is working with headhunters on a hunt for Gerry Murphy’s successor.

Mr Murphy, who also chairs Tesco, is not expected to step down this year, although the precise timing has yet to be formally determined, according to insiders.

Last summer, Sky News reported that Burberry had commenced a search for a non-executive director capable of taking over from Mr Murphy in due course.

That mandate is now said to have evolved into a more straightforward hunt for a new chair, sources suggested.

Planning for his departure comes as Burberry and other luxury goods manufacturers grapple with the uncertainty of swingeing tariffs amid an escalating international trade war.

The company is now being run by Joshua Schulman, the former Jimmy Choo boss, who was drafted in last July to arrest its decline.

Mr Schulman replaced Jonathan Akeroyd, who left in the wake of a string of profit warnings.

Shares in Burberry closed on Tuesday at 738.8p, giving it a market value of about £2.6bn.

The stock is down by more than a third over the last year.

A spokesperson for Burberry said: “In the normal course of business, we look at succession planning for board roles as they reach term.”
